Transaction 01330508780ccb831b1d94bcd3459f81521d9981b0a20a17543ef697b246e62f
1 Input
1 Output
-
01330508780ccb831b1d94bcd3459f81521d9981b0a20a17543ef697b246e62f:0
- value
- 169413
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d2007761b0efe3312e35bedcb575176c1f2417a OP_EQUAL
- address
- 3QmRFW1MSDHJzv8uzsTfhqFhjXCpz9sPLf